Transaction 67698257620488edc9df3b416009ba3f80af4dcd3315801ecc6a3ccd222a74f6
1 Input
1 Output
-
67698257620488edc9df3b416009ba3f80af4dcd3315801ecc6a3ccd222a74f6:0
- value
- 182280
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95dace7cf97089754018a9151c348a48a941d802 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EfMoXpmXLgfK1bq3zmaHfR5E6DtXxs2VR